E-commerce Operations Manager JD
JOB SUMMARY
This transformational solution will enable the expansion of our distribution network and support eCommerce growth. This is an opportunity to be part of a great success story as L Oreal continues to impact the business as no other company can. We are looking for a self-motivated, results-oriented, creative thinker to oversee the team. The keys to success are a strong sense of urgency, efficiency, and accuracy.
The successful OMS Manager will collaborate with fellow team members and local operations leadership to drive operational improvement. The OMS Manager must be well-versed in distribution and supply chain operations, performance benchmarking, and KPI/dashboard development.
Experience with database management and related tools is a strong plus.
The ideal candidate is process-oriented and always looking for opportunities to streamline and improve. The individual in this role will work with cross-functional teams to solve complex business issues involving order fulfillment, operational compliance, and inventory optimization.
Core Responsibilities
Oversee team of analysts responsible for maintaining day-to-day operations related to inventory and order flow
Develop strategy to improve efficiency in hold management
Expert in technical and operational flows, identifying root causes and develop action plan to address issues
Support the development and continuous improvement of standards along with implementation and improvements of systems.
Represent team on calls with cross-functional partners
Lead Peak Planning and Management
Responsible for hitting MTD SHIP goals and maintaining SLA
